Transaction e4f071f0588d75dda5944e5dde731be158c5ef056f3baf01d0dcdeed73e05103
1 Input
1 Output
-
e4f071f0588d75dda5944e5dde731be158c5ef056f3baf01d0dcdeed73e05103:0
- value
- 674646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fb4df7d31cedaf5afc83cca024cc3a06af39cea OP_EQUAL
- address
- 3Bsfc7YJwuUfCYc8BTwS6qmEJ2krn98fjU